Why Capacitor Energy Storage Matters in Modern Industries

Unlike traditional batteries, capacitors store energy electrostatically, enabling rapid charging/discharging cycles and exceptional durability. This makes them ideal for scenarios requiring instant power bursts or frequent energy cycling. Let's break down their key advantages:

  • Ultra-fast response times (milliseconds)
  • Over 1 million charge cycles
  • 80-95% efficiency in energy transfer
  • Minimal maintenance requirements

Technical Comparison: Capacitors vs. Batteries

Here's how the technologies stack up for short-term energy storage:

  • Power Density: Capacitors (10 kW/kg) vs. Batteries (0.3 kW/kg)
  • Cycle Life: Capacitors (>500,000) vs. Batteries (1,000-5,000)
  • Temperature Range: Capacitors (-40°C to +85°C) vs. Batteries (0°C to +45°C)
